In this field trip, students will explore the cultures, landscapes, and animals encountered by the Corps of Discovery as the traveled and mapped the newly purchased Louisiana Territory. They will also learn about the lives of Lewis and Clark and the people they interacted with during the voyage.
Virtual programs typically last around 20-25 minutes with time for Q&A. Please be prepared to share your screen or hosting capability with the ranger so they can use any digital materials they have created. The ranger will also email the teacher any suggested activities and sujbect specific materials ahead of time. Reservations must be made at least 30 days in advance.
